In the car industry, underglow or ground effects lighting refers to neon or LED aftermarket car customization in which lights are attached to the underside of the chassis so that they illuminate the ground underneath the car. Yes, under Iowa Code section 321.423 (3)it is illegal to have blue lights on a motor vehicle in Iowa unless the vehicle is owned by a fire department or is an authorized emergency vehicle. Neon car lights, also referred to as underglow lights, are non-standard neon or LED lights that attach to the under body of a car, truck, or motorcycle. Blue and red are not allowed on public streets in some states because they can distract drivers and be confused with police cars. Particularly the colors blue and red, as well as any kind of flashing light effects, are banned from public streets in some states as they can distract drivers or be confused with police cars. Flashing light restrictions often also include all kinds of rotating, oscillating, color-changing, moving, fading, or otherwise non-stationary (steady) emitting glow.
